Micro-Climate Calendar: Match Cut Timing to Your Exact Zip Code
Standard advice says “prune in late spring,” yet that window can swing six weeks across the Great Plains. Track soil temperature at 2-inch depth; when it holds steady at 55 °F for three consecutive mornings, prairie dock and rosinweed are primed for a cutback that yields 30 % taller flower stalks.
Urban heat islands advance the trigger by ten days, while low swales delay it. Log your own garden’s micro-data for two seasons; the pattern becomes a personal alarm clock more reliable than any regional calendar.
Tools That Make the Cut: Selecting Blades for Each Prairie Texture
Smooth blue stem’s wiry foliage dulls standard bypass pruners in three snips. Switch to a Japanese double-bevel grass sickle; its razor edge slices without crushing the vascular bundles, preventing the silver streak die-back common with blunt tools.
For the pithy cores of mature cup plants, a fine-toothed folding pruning saw removes 1-inch thick stalks in one pull. The resulting smooth, slanted surface sheds water, eliminating the fungal entry points that plague jagged hand-clipper cuts.
Keep a holstered spray bottle of 70 % ethanol at your hip; dip blades between species to halt the spread of aster yellows phytoplasma. One overlooked infected plant can turn an entire border into a witches’-broom spectacle by August.

Crown Versus Root: Where the Real Decision Happens
Many gardeners hack indiscriminately at prairie foliage without realizing the cut’s altitude determines whether buds awaken above or below ground. Removing just the top third of purple coneflower forces the crown to break dormancy, yielding bushier plants that resist flopping.
Shear the same plant to soil level and you gamble on root buds; if stored starches are low after a wet winter, regrowth emerges weaker and blooms two weeks late. The workaround is a two-tier cut: leave four inches of last year’s stem as a visual marker, then prune fresh growth by half in June.
This dual strategy keeps the crown active while stimulating basal shoots, effectively creating a living trellis that supports taller flower stems through prairie winds.

Bloom-Phase Pinching: Extend Color by 40 Days
Once butterfly milkweed opens its first tangerine umbel, pinch every other developing inflorescence by 50 %. The plant responds by activating secondary buds, staging a second flush that peaks just as monarchs begin their southward migration.
Prairie blazing star operates on a different timer. Wait until one third of its rosy wands have unfurled, then deadhead the top quarter of each spike. Energy diverts to lateral flower buds, turning a three-week show into a six-week magnet for swallowtails.
Record the date of each pinch; after two seasons you’ll map a personal succession chart that keeps your patch in continuous bloom from solstice to equinox.

Fall Chop Timing: Sync With Seed Dispersal and Winter Prep
Goldenrod sets seed when pappus turns silk-white, usually three weeks before first frost. Postpone cutting until 30 % of seeds have scattered; birds like American goldfinch rely on that staggered bounty.
After seed release, shear stems to 8 inches. The remaining stubble traps wind-blown leaves, creating a natural mulch that insures rough blazing star rosettes against freeze-thaw cycles.
Leave rattlesnake master stalks intact until December; their hollow internodes become overwintering chambers for small carpenter bees. A single 18-inch segment can house 40 juvenile bees, boosting next spring’s pollination workforce.

Rejuvenate Decadent Clumps: The 3-Year Rotation Plan
Older prairie patches thin at the center, creating doughnut shapes. Instead of digging the entire clump, mark one third of the circumference with biodegradable flagging tape each spring. Cut flagged sections to ground level, compost the debris in place, and dust the stump with a handful of crushed eggshell for slow-release calcium.
The following year, move the flag clockwise; by year three the first segment has rebounded with juvenile vigor, yielding twice the bloom density of an unmanaged clump. This rotating shock prevents the bare-center syndrome that plagues ten-year-old little bluestem plantings.
Side benefit: the trimmed biomass smothers weeds, saving mulch expense and outcompeting invasive sweet clover seedlings that otherwise exploit open soil.

Record-Keeping Hacks: Turn Pruning Data Into Predictive Power
A waterproof field notebook tucked in a pruner holster becomes a seasonal playbook. Log date, weather, soil moisture, and exact cut height for each species. After two seasons, patterns emerge: you discover that cutting aromatic sumac to 10 inches on July 14 produces maximum fall color, whereas June cuts invite powdery mildew.
Transfer notes to a spreadsheet; color-code cells by bloom success rate. The visual grid quickly reveals that late-summer rain within five days of cutting boosts regrowth more than irrigation, saving water and labor.
